What Is a Bail Bond?
A bail bond is an economic contract that allows an apprehended person to be released from safekeeping while waiting for test. This setup includes a 3rd party, typically a bondsman, that assures the court that the person will return for their arranged court looks. For this service, the Bail bondsman normally bills a non-refundable charge, commonly a percent of the overall Bail amount.
Bail bonds offer an essential feature in the legal system, supplying a device for accuseds to preserve their liberty throughout the pre-trial stage. This can aid them plan for their defense a lot more successfully. The Bail amount is figured out by the court based on numerous variables, including the intensity of the offense, the offender's criminal history, and the risk of trip. Inevitably, a bail bond represents a commitment to copyright legal responsibilities while allowing people the possibility to proceed their day-to-days live up until their court day.
How Bail Bonds Job
Bail bonds operate via a simple procedure that entails numerous essential steps. Originally, an offender or their representative calls a bail bond representative after an apprehension. The agent evaluates the situation, consisting of the Bail quantity established by the accused and the court's background. When a choice is made, the agent typically calls for a non-refundable charge, usually a percent of the total Bail amount, commonly ranging from 10% to 15%.
After the charge is paid, the agent safeguards the Bail by authorizing an agreement with the court, making certain that the accused stands for all set up court days. If the offender falls short to show up, the bail bond agent is in charge of the full Bail amount, leading the representative to choose the offender. Throughout this procedure, the bail bond agent plays a vital function in promoting the release of the accused while taking care of the linked economic threats.
Types of Bail Bonds
Understanding the numerous kinds of Bail bonds is necessary for offenders and their families as they browse the lawful system. There are a number of typical kinds of Bail bonds available, each offering a details function.
One of the most common is the guaranty bond, which entails a bondsman assuring the complete Bail amount in exchange for a fee. An additional type is the cash money bond, where the offender or their family members pays the full Bail quantity in cash money directly to the court.
Property bonds allow people to make use of property as security for the Bail quantity. Furthermore, government bonds are specific to government situations, commonly calling for a higher costs and a lot more rigorous problems.
Lastly, immigration bonds are made use of in cases worrying immigration offenses. Each sort of bond has distinctive procedures and ramifications, making it crucial for those included to recognize their choices extensively.
The Prices Included in Safeguarding a Bail Bond
Securing a bail bond entails various costs that can significantly impact a defendant's funds. The principal expense is the costs, usually varying from 10% to 15% of the total Bail amount established by the court. This costs is non-refundable, no matter the case outcome, representing the bail bond representative's fee for their services. Additional expenses may consist of management fees, which some agents impose for handling documents, and security demands, where the defendant might require to offer possessions to safeguard the bond. Usual Misconceptions About Bail Bonds
Lots of people harbor mistaken beliefs concerning Bail bonds, which can complicate my link their understanding of the Bail process. One prevalent myth is that Bail bonds are a kind of settlement that guarantees a defendant's release. Actually, they are an assurance to the court that the offender will certainly show up for their scheduled hearings. Another usual belief is that only rich individuals can pay for Bail. Bail bondsmen generally bill a portion of the total Bail amount, making it accessible to a broader range of individuals. Additionally, some individuals think that Bail is refundable. While the premium paid to the bondsman is not refundable, the Bail amount itself might be returned upon the conclusion of the instance, supplied the offender fulfills all court needs. Resolving these misconceptions is crucial for people traversing the complexities of the Bail system and ensuring they make educated choices.
